Output fa421fab274a46fcb1cfdbe96c00bc533711f27565fc7a2419b2454a0a932202:7

value
15520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c4224317984ec2e96bc68a79e02860aa572d111 OP_EQUAL
address
38eEWhvx167LfMfzbwUDu8GcfcmZv2z8aB
transaction
fa421fab274a46fcb1cfdbe96c00bc533711f27565fc7a2419b2454a0a932202
confirmations
431918
spent
true